    Description

    The Department of Veterans Affairs is soliciting proposals for the procurement of the Scope Buddy Plus, along with its accessories, for use at the Fayetteville VA Medical Center in North Carolina. This solicitation aims to acquire endoscopic flushing aids that are crucial for the effective cleaning and sanitizing of endoscopes, thereby enhancing patient safety in medical procedures. The procurement emphasizes plug-and-play convenience, requiring no special installations, and is open to small business set-asides, with proposals due by May 23, 2025.     The document outlines a solicitation for the procurement of medical and surgical equipment, specifically the Scope Buddy Plus with accessories, used at the Department of Veterans Affairs' Fayetteville VA Medical Center. The requisition is part of a broader aim to acquire endoscopic flushing aids to ensure the effective cleaning and sanitizing of endoscopes, vital for patient safety. The solicitation details various items, including models and quantities, along with vendor and technical requirements emphasizing plug-and-play convenience and no special installations. It specifies eligibility for small business set-asides and mandates that contractors participate through the System for Award Management (SAM), ensuring compliance with federal acquisition regulations. Proposals are due by May 23, 2025, with pricing as the key evaluation criterion. Additionally, it includes essential terms and clauses related to contract execution, recording of payments, and deliverable locations, reinforcing the legal and operational framework necessary for this procurement.
